Dimensions: 11-½”H x 5-½”Diameter This pair of brass candlesticks are a wonderful find! Crafted in the distinctive style of Claude Galle during the 1st empire period in France, circa 1810. Three female busts dressed in a Hellenistic style beautifully adorn the stem of the flambeaux above paw feet and a palm frond ornamented base. Quite heavy and of fantastic quality, this pair of candlestick holders will elevate any space. Make sure to view the remaining photographs to view the intricate detail throughout.
